Renal Haemodialysis Satellite Services
Notice Description
University Hospitals Birmingham NHS Foundation Trust ("UHB") runs the Queen Elizabeth Hospital Birmingham (QEHB), Birmingham Chest Clinic, Birmingham Heartlands Hospital, Good Hope Hospital, Solihull Hospital and various community services across the region. <br/><br/>The Trust is seeking to continue to improve efficiency and increase quality of care for patients and to appoint a managed service supplier(s) to supply services and to provide a high quality, seamless haemodialysis service for all patients. <br/><br/>The Trust's wishes to secure a high quality, comprehensive, patient-centred, integrated care and treatment for patients with end stage kidney disease (ESKD) that require maintenance dialysis treatment by haemodialysis.
